11 Nov 2025 / Singapore
Work to demolish the existing premises and reinstate the shoreline at 23 Shipyard Rd will be carried out from 12 November to 12 January 2026.
According to the Maritime and Port Authority of Singapore Port Marine Notice No.150 of 2025, the work will be carried out 24 hours daily - including Sundays and public holidays - at sea within the working area bounded by the following coordinates (WGS 84 Datum):
1) 01°18.375'N / 103°41.634'E
2) 01°18.369'N / 103°41.650'E
3) 01°18.240'N / 103°41.639'E
4) 01°18.346'N / 103°41.623'E
The work involves the delivery of armour rocks, construction of the shoreline profile and laying of the shore protection.
Safety boats will be deployed to warn other crafts in the vicinity of the working area.
Craft involved in the works will exhibit the appropriate local and international day and night signals.
When in the vicinity of the working area, mariners are reminded to:
a) Keep well clear and not to enter the working area;
b) Maintain a proper lookout;
c) Proceed at a safe speed and navigate with caution;
d) Maintain a listening watch on VHF Channel 22 (Jurong Control); and communicate with Jurong Control for assistance if required.
